    Thursday 10.08.09: MR. GREEN ALL STARS (HR – Bad Brains, ROCKY GEORGE – Suicidal Tendencies, NORWOOD FISHER – Fishbone, THE SCIENTIST) @ echoplex

    This is a fucking super group if I've ever heard of one. The band consists of HR from Bad Brains, Norwood Fisher of Fishbone on bass, Rocky George of Suicidal Tendencies on guitar, and DH Peligro of Dead Kennedys on drums. I'm serious. I know. You HAVE to see this. Mr. Green All Stars will launch a world tour this fall - it starts in at the Echoplex. Officially, Mr. Green's All-Stars describe themselves as "misfits of the world who believe in freedom of expression—no matter what the cost.” Check out the video below and listen to some of the tunes on their myspace before you judge.     NPR Streams New Yo La Tengo Album in its Entirety

    September 1, 2009 from WXPN - One of America's most influential and captivating rock bands, Hoboken, N.J.'s Yo La Tengo celebrates its 25th anniversary with the release of Popular Songs, which continues the trio's tradition of balancing soft acoustic pop with dark, enthralling rock. Guitarist/vocalist Ira Kaplan, drummer/vocalist Georgia Hubley and bassist/vocalist James McNew have made another impeccably crafted delight, which you can hear in its entirety here, for the week prior to its release on Sept. 8.

    THE JAZZ BUTCHER IS PLAYING PTP FEST 2

    The Jazz Butcher, also known as The Jazz Butcher Conspiracy and The Jazz Butcher And His Sikkorskis From Hell, are a British musical group founded by Pat Fish. Their oeuvre is blackly humorous with such topics as Thomas Pynchon's The Crying of Lot 49, an unrequited crush on Shirley Maclaine, and an ode to SF writer Harlan Ellison. The song "Sister Death" is not about the comic book character

    RIP Allen Shellenberger, 1969-2009

    So I'm not sure how I missed this, but I just heard from my guitarist yesterday that the drummer from Lit had passed away about 2 weeks ago.  The band released the following statement on their MySpace: Allen Shellenberger, drummer for Orange County rock band Lit, lost his battle with brain cancer Thursday, August 13, 2009 surrounded by his loving family, the band, and close friends. He was 39 years old.
